FAQ
1. Is it safe to use psyllium husk daily?
Yes, for most people, but it’s important to drink plenty of water and not exceed recommended doses.
2. Can children use it?
Small doses may be safe for children, but consult a pediatrician before giving fiber supplements.
3. How fast does it work?
Effects usually appear within 30 minutes to 2 hours depending on hydration and digestive health.
4. Are there side effects?
Possible mild bloating or gas if not taken with enough water. Excessive use may cause diarrhea.
5. Can it replace medical treatment for constipation?
No. Persistent or chronic constipation should be evaluated by a healthcare professional.
